Did you know?
Software development and technology is crucial for innovation. We create our own systems from scratch.
Scania has autonomous mining trucks on the market and piloting autonomous transportation solutions for on the road.
Approximately 3000 employees at Scania in Sweden works within Software Development for the whole TRATON group.
Scania is part of the TRATON Group, together with MAN, International, and Volkswagen Truck & Bus.

TRATON GROUP
TRATON GROUP is one of the world’s leading commercial vehicle manufacturers. It consists of the brands Scania, MAN, International and Volkswagen Truck & Bus. The Group’s product portfolio comprises trucks, buses, and light-duty commercial vehicles. The TRATON R&D is located in Södertälje and works with development of autonomous solutions cross all brands.
